FlashNuk 发表于 2011-10-4 10:18:09

网上下载的AVR ip core请问如何在QuartusII 工程中用起来?上传AVR CORE 源码。

rt

附件怎么也上传不了啦,等会上传吧。

zbjzxc 发表于 2011-10-4 10:25:27

这个要记号~~

FlashNuk 发表于 2011-10-4 14:19:24

点击此处下载 ourdev_682033PBDMUC.rar(文件大小:74K) (原文件名:AVR_Core8F.rar)

FlashNuk 发表于 2011-10-4 17:50:35

另外一个AVR IP COREourdev_682123B8OF2Q.rar(文件大小:75K) (原文件名:VHDL语言编写的AVR单片机IP核.rar)

stirwl 发表于 2011-10-4 17:59:16

在tools 里有个mega plugin吧

Nuker 发表于 2011-10-4 18:13:28

原始代码是用Xilinx的BRAM实现PMEM和DMEM的,见Memory目录。
你需要用MegaCore产生基于Altera目标器件的Memory替代,但是要注意时序是否兼容,最好先用ModelSim先仿真一下。
仿真验证完成后就可以将所有的VHDL文件加到Quartus工程里面,然后约束管脚和时序,编译,下载调试就可以了。

2006lc 发表于 2011-10-4 18:15:48

谢谢分享

mikkkz 发表于 2011-10-4 19:43:31

哪位山寨个AVR....

fuliaokai 发表于 2011-10-4 20:49:44

这个可以看看!

FlashNuk 发表于 2011-10-4 22:06:12

5楼兄弟,有没有类似的Altera的IP CORE的开发手册共享一下?

Nuker 发表于 2011-10-4 22:34:33

http://www.altera.com.cn/literature/ug/ug_ram_rom.pdf

Quartus菜单:Tools -> MegaWizard Plug-in Manager
然后选择:Create a new custom megacore variation
进入“Memory Compiler”类别选择,指定语言类型为VHDL,输出名称...

FlashNuk 发表于 2011-10-5 10:36:36

没看明白楼上兄弟提供的做法。

Nuker 发表于 2011-10-6 17:53:56

一句话,就是你得用MegaCore Wizard产生可以放到你目标器件里面的RAM模块,用来作为AVR的PMEM和DMEM。
页: [1]
查看完整版本: 网上下载的AVR ip core请问如何在QuartusII 工程中用起来?上传AVR CORE 源码。